How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bradley County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bradley County Studio Apartments | $945 | $850 | $1,404 |
| Bradley County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,179 | $750 | $1,525 |
| Bradley County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,377 | $850 | $1,829 |
| Bradley County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,522 | $900 | $1,869 |
| Bradley County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,443 | $1,443 | $1,443 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Bradley County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Bradley County with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in Bradley County is at Park Hills Apartments listed at $825.
How much is the average rent for a Studio Bradley County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Bradley County is $945.
What is the largest available Studio Bradley County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Bradley County is a 490 square feet unit starting from $825 at Park Hills Apartments.
What is the average size for Bradley County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Bradley County is currently 446 sq ft.
